Round 7: Tossup 1
Maximum overlaps of these entities are described in the limitation similarity theory. Seven models for the apportionment of these entities such as dominance decay and MacArthur fractions were ranked by Mutsunori Tokeshi to explain relative abundance distributions. G. Evelyn Hutchinson represented these entities as n-dimensional hypervolumes. Joseph H. Connell proposed “ghosts of competitions past and present” to explain these entities’ “differentiation.” That scientist also studied barnacle habitat ranges in describing the “fundamental” and “realized” types of these entities. The competitive exclusion rule that states two species sharing identical ones of these entities cannot coexist. For 10 points, name these entities that describe how an organism matches its environmental factors. ■END■
